Mount Everest is the highest mountain in the world at 8,849 meters above sea level, located in the Himalayas on the border between Nepal and China. Kanchenjunga is third highest, while Godwin Austen (K2) is second highest. 'Visuveus' appears to be a misspelling, possibly of Vesuvius which is not a major peak.
